Transaction 46e3962488a7326321f3f261d77ac378fc630f6f305b3583cbb1484af35ba603
1 Input
1 Output
-
46e3962488a7326321f3f261d77ac378fc630f6f305b3583cbb1484af35ba603:0
- value
- 577932
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 dea3b1fa70b70a93047d8170de10f1dc4aa78022 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1MJD7L9gSkFtXxqJcs2o9HE1VLt2MnzrM2